#8715: fortran-20100118 ignores SAGE_FORTRAN on Linux

 On Linux, fortran-20100118.spkg's spkg-install ignores SAGE_FORTRAN and
 instead overrides it with the first "gfortran" it finds in $PATH.  In my
 environment this fortran compiler is (more or less) broken, so I have to
 it explicitly and I then want it to be used.  The simple attached fix
 executes the relevant code path only if SAGE_FORTRAN is not set yet.
